Mesothelioma Litigation

Mesothelioma suits seek compensation for victims. A lawsuit could help families pay for expensive medical bills and give peace of mind.

Lawsuits can be filed as individual actions or as class action lawsuits. Many mesothelioma lawyers prefer individual actions because Supreme Court rulings against class actions have led to this preference.

Asbestos trusts are a major source of funds for manufacturers to pay settlements and jury awards relating to mesothelioma. Settlement amounts are kept private due to confidentiality agreements, but they are publicized periodically.

Damages

Mesothelioma patients and their families can receive compensation for a variety of expenses, including medical costs loss of income, the effect that the disease can have on quality of living. The amount of compensation will be determined by a variety of factors like the severity and stage of the disease, the number of asbestos-related companies are named in the lawsuit and whether the defendant deliberately exposed the plaintiff to asbestos.

Most mesothelioma cases are settled before trial. This allows for a faster resolution and avoids the costs of litigation. If the case goes to trial, the jury will determine the amount of damages that will be awarded to the plaintiff.

Settlements

In general, the most significant aspect of any mesothelioma lawsuit is the amount of money awarded to victims and their families. The purpose of this compensation is to cover treatment-related expenses and lost wages as a result of being unable to go to work, loss of companionship and other expenses. A mesothelioma lawyer who is skilled will build a strong case to ensure the victim receives the maximum compensation they can get.

The majority of mesothelioma patients are compensated through negotiated settlements. The amount of the settlement is contingent on a variety of factors such as the severity of the disease and how much the patient has incurred in medical and other bills, and whether the death was a result of the illness. Defense attorneys may try to reduce the amount however a kn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er can thwart their demands.

Compensation amounts from mesothelioma lawsuits can be substantial and can be life-changing for victims and their families. Compensation for both the victim and their loved ones can be used for anything from settling debt to reimbursing living expenses. In addition to the actual compensation, those suffering of mesothelioma can also receive compensation for their unintentional exposure and the negative impact it has caused on their lives.

Mesothelioma lawsuits usually fall under personal injury or wrongful death claims. A mesothelioma lawsuit filed on behalf of a person who has been diagnosed with the disease is considered as a personal injury claim however, a mesothelioma claim filed on behalf of a deceased person's family members is a wrongful death claim.

Both types of lawsuits award victims compensation through mesothelioma trust funds as well as settlements. In addition, they can also receive compensation from verdicts and lawsuits. In most cases, the type or claim does not affect the amount of money given.

For example, a mesothelioma jury verdict given to a victim will be subject to the same tax laws as any other award from a lawsuit regardless of whether it originates from an estate trust fund, settlement or trial. However, it does matter whether a mesothelioma settlement verdict contains punitive damages since this amount will be subject to taxes in most cases. The same applies to any money withdrawn from a mesothelioma trust fund or judgment.

Trials

In the past, a number of mesothelioma cases that went to court resulted in settlements of millions of dollars for the victims. However, today almost all asbestos cases settle without a trial. Most asbestos lawsuits are settled outside of court due to the fact that the companies involved have declared bankruptcy. They don't want a large verdict from a jury. In addition, victims are less likely to get a bigger verdict if they are going to trial due to the numerous factors that influence the outcome of a case.

The capacity of the plaintiff and defendant to reach a settlement is contingent on a variety of factors. One of these variables is how close the parties are to the statute-of limitations deadline. A skilled attorney experienced in mesothelioma claims can help victims and their families decide the best option to suit their specific circumstances.

Mesothelioma lawsuits can also compensate victims for medical expenses, lost income, pain and suffering, and other damages. Compensation is crucial, particularly for those who have to stop working due to their illness. The cost of treating mesothelioma is usually extremely high. A mesothelioma diagnosis can mean that family members will need to leave work in order to care for their loved one, which results in lost earnings.

Asbestos-related illness lawsuits can assist victims families, as well as corporations to be held accountable for their mistakes. Asbestos-related victims have received compensation that allowed them to pay for medical treatment, replace income lost and provide financial security to their loved relatives. Lawsuits have also discouraged companies from promoting asbestos-related products that are dangerous.

Asbestos litigation may involve individual lawsuits as well as class action lawsuits. However, most asbestos claims are dealt with as personal injury suits. Mesothelioma cases are usually filed as part of a multidistrict litigation (MDL). This is a group of similar asbestos cases which are handled simultaneously to maximize efficiency, however the individual claims are kept separate.

If a mesothelioma-related lawsuit can't be resolved through mediation or another resolution method it is likely to be a trial. During a trial parties will be able to present evidence before the jury and a judge. Trials can last weeks or even months. Mesothelioma suits can be complicated and require expert testimony. This can increase the time it takes to make a decision.
